🍺 About the Pub
The Three Stags Heads Inn is a traditional 300-year-old village pub located in Wardlow Mires, Derbyshire. It features a historic, largely unaltered interior with stone-flagged floors, an ancient cast iron range, and a cosy atmosphere that reflects old-fashioned values. This Grade II listed pub offers a welcoming Motorhome Pub Stopover opportunity, suitable for visitors looking for authentic local charm combined with Motorhome Parking.

🍽️ Food
The pub offers locally sourced traditional food, including dishes such as Hancock’s pork pies served with a selection of pickles. Thursday night pizza events occur monthly, adding to the classic pub fare. Overall, the emphasis is on quality and heritage rather than contemporary dining trends.

🗺️ Interesting Things To Do Nearby (Within 5 Miles)
1. Treak Cliff Cavern
Located approximately 3 miles from the pub, Treak Cliff Cavern is a fascinating show cave known for its rare Blue John stone. Visitors can take guided tours to explore the caverns and learn about the local geology and mining history, making it an educational and scenic nearby attraction perfect for those stopping over in their motorhomes.
2. Peak District National Park
A vast area covering much of Derbyshire, including Wardlow Mires, the Peak District offers stunning landscapes, walking trails, and historic sites. It’s an ideal outdoor destination just minutes from the pub, suitable for hiking or cycling right from your Motorhome Parking spot.
3. Eyam Village
About 4.5 miles away lies Eyam, the “Plague Village,” known for its poignant history and heritage centre. Visitors can explore fascinating museums and buildings that recount a unique story of self-sacrifice, enriching any Motorhome Stopover in this historic area.
4. Bakewell
Approximately 5 miles from the Three Stags Heads Inn, Bakewell is famed for its charming market town vibe and Bakewell tart delicacy. It offers shops, eateries, and riverside walks, complementing the Motorhome Pub Stopover experience with additional leisure and shopping options.
5. Monsal Trail
A popular walking and cycling trail just 4 miles away, the Monsal Trail runs through tunnels and over viaducts, showcasing beautiful Peak District scenery. It’s an excellent activity to enjoy near this Motorhome Parking site, especially for outdoor enthusiasts.
